I pretty much taught myself with this booklet http://www.ebay.com/itm/Successful-M...sAAOSwNE5YWu-O and used a satin stitch.I have some pictures in my albums. As for consistency I made a sample of every width and lenght I could and wrote that down. It takes practice, but a lot of fun. I use different stiches now though. Satin stiches can be time consuming.
